Can we handle content convertion for TabDelimiter flat file in JMS

Hi,
Is it possible to handle content conversion for TabDelimiter flat file in JMS (Not in FILE adapter).
If possible .. can you please explain.
Regards,
Siva.

Hi, Siva:
Yes, this is possible.
The way that JMS adapter to handle content cnversion is similar to the way file adapter does.
Different from file adapter, you do not have to specify "Content Conversion" as transport protocol, you need to use transformation bean (localejbs/AF_Modules/MessageTransformBean) in Module tab.

  • Call Pipeline in orchestration for converting XML to flat file

    Hi ,
    Can we call Pipeline in orchestration for converting XML to flat file ?
    Or we have some another option for this task ?
    Prakash

    Hi,
    You can refer this article from Abdul Rafay on how to work with Flat files and how to call receive and send pipelines within your orchestration. He
    has provided detailed step by step explanation of the process.
    Calling Send and Receive Pipelines
    from the orchestration expression shapes
    The code shared by Abdul at http://abdulrafaysbiztalk.wordpress.com/files/2009/06/processingflatfiles.doc (Change the extention to rar) and try it.
    One common mistake I have seen people doing will working with Flat File Assembler is that they miss to set the Document schema property in the Properties
    window to the flat file schema.
    If the Document schema property is not specified, runtime schema discovery will be attempted. During schema discovery, BizTalk Server attempts
    to determine the correct flat file schema to assemble the message with, based on the namespace and root node of the message, its added performance hit.

  • Can PowerPC applications be converted for use with Lion OSX? If so, how?

    Can PowerPC applications be converted for use with Lion OSX? Ifso, how?

    Three workarounds:
    1.  If your Mac supports it, partition your internal hard drive or use an external drive and install Snow Leopard.  Then you can "dual-boot" into Snow Leopard when you want to run your PowerPC applications.
    2.  Upgrade and/or find alternative replacements for your PPC software that run without Rosetta.
    3.  Install Snow Leopard (with Rosetta) into Parallels 7 in Lion:

  • How to create a dynamic SSIS package for multiple flat file destinations

    Hi,
    I have to create a ssis package which has single data flow task and inside that I have 23 source (sql- select * from - statements)- destination (flat files, 23 distinct) connection.
    Now for each product I have to create separate SSIS package (i.e. if prod=abc then these read select * from abc_tables and 23 abc_ txt files)
    I want to do it dynamically, means only single package and inside that variables will take select * values for each source-dest connection (so i believe 23 variables) and same for destination flat files.
    Let me know. :)
    ANK HIT - if reply helps, please mark it as ANSWER or helpful post

    Sorry It seems you're contradicting yourself. you say I know my source and dest structure and the you're
    asking all I want is to have a dynamic structure
    what does that mean?
    and reading your next sentence
    I want to run a package for 5 products, instead of creating 5 ssis packages with 23 source- dest connection, I would
    like to have one with only 23 source- dest connections 
    What I feel is what you're looking for is to  have a looping structure to loop through each of the 5
    products.
    In that case what you could do is this
    1. Create a object variable in SSIS 
    2. Use a Execute SQL Task to populate the variable with all available products (I think you'll have a master table for that). Set ResultSet property to Full ResultSet and then in ResultSet tab map Object variable to 0 th index
    3. use a ForEachLoop container with ADO .NET recordset enumerator and map to object variable. Create a variable of datatype same as that of Product identifier field to get individual values out
    4. Inside loop create your data flow task with 23 source destination connection. In the query part use a parameter for product field and map it to the variable containing product value to get only data for the product.

  • Convert amount from flat file format to user format

    hi,
    how to convert amount from flat file format to user specific format.
    input:  1000.00
    output: 1.000,00 (user specific)
    thanks in advance

    move that value to a type WRBTR variable
    and use write statement.
    data v_wrbtr type wrbtr.
    data v_char(20).
    v_wrbtr = 1000.
    write v_wrbtr to v_char.
    v_char will contain the amount in user format.
    Prerequsite, go to SU3 transaction.
    Defaults tab, chose the decimal notation .
